Alyssa Healy Bids ODI Farewell with Record-Breaking 158

Australian cricketing legend Alyssa Healy ended her illustrious One Day International (ODI) career in spectacular fashion, smashing a breathtaking 158 off just 98 balls as her team whitewashed India 3-0 in the series. The 33-year-old, who announced her retirement from ODI cricket earlier this year, marked her final appearance with a dazzling century.

A Fitting Tribute to a Remarkable Career

Healy’s incredible innings, laced with 27 fours and two sixes, was a fitting tribute to her remarkable career, which has been a defining chapter in Australian women’s cricket. As she walked off the field for the last time, the Indian team gave her a guard of honour, a testament to the respect and admiration she commands in the cricketing fraternity.
